♨️ Hot Springs Emoji Meaning

♨️ Hot Springs emoji is geothermal relaxation and mineral-rich bliss — the natural thermal baths where stress dissolves in steaming water.

The ♨️ Hot Springs emoji captures that ultimate zen moment—soaking in naturally heated water surrounded by steam and nature. It’s universally understood as a symbol of wellness, self-care, and escape from daily stress. Hot springs have roots in Japanese onsen culture, Korean jjimjilbangs, and Icelandic thermal pools. The emoji reflects a global wellness movement that’s become central to self-care conversations. It’s iconic in Japanese culture specifically, where onsen bathing is a centuries-old tradition tied to community and healing.

♨️ Hot Springs Emoji Fun Facts

  • ♨️ First appeared in Unicode 6.0 (2010) as part of the travel and places category, making it one of the older wellness emojis on the block.
  • ♨️ Japan’s emoji usage of ♨️ is off the charts—it’s used more frequently there than anywhere else, reflecting onsen culture’s deep roots in daily life and tourism.

♨️ Hot Springs Emoji FAQ

What's the actual difference between ♨️ hot springs and 🧖 person in steamy room emoji?

Great question. ♨️ is specifically the *location*—the outdoor or natural hot spring pool itself, often shown with steam rising. 🧖 is about the *person* soaking in a steamy bath environment. Use ♨️ when talking about the destination, and 🧖 when emphasizing the self-care experience or relaxation feeling.
